What You Need to Know about G2’s Active Metadata Management Category
Metadata is what describes your data. It’s the label on your containers that tells you which one contains sugar or salt. It's the card that the valet gives you when you park your vehicle at the shopping mall. In the world of tech, it includes information such as the author of a file, file size, time of creation, last updated, etc., (basic metadata elements). Most of this data has remained passive for the longest time (just storing data in a static catalog), leaving the wealth of data insights it can generate unexplored.

Reducing the High Costs of Data Storage with Data Deduplication
How much data storage do businesses need for storage and backup? Four of the biggest online storage internet companies (Google, Amazon, Microsoft, and Facebook) store at least 1,200 petabytes (PB), which is 1.2 million terabytes (TB). Even for smaller companies, it is remarkable how much data it manages.

Question on: Openprise
What are the Openprise capabilities?What can I do with Openrpise?

Clean Up Your Data
Nothing works when your data’s a mess. Deploy Openprise bots to:
Cleanse Data: Fix typos, formatting, and other errors to improve personalization, scoring, segmentation, and routing.
Normalize Field Values: Standardize fields with your unique values. No more creating 50 keyword filters to segment on a single field.
Dedupe: Dedupe and merge leads, contacts, and accounts based on your company’s criteria. Get attribution, routing, and scoring you can count on.
Match Leads to Accounts: Get the fundamentals down pat for lead routing, attribution, lead scoring, and account scoring.
Convert Leads to Contacts: Automate mopping up after your reps since they don’t get compensated on data hygiene.
Unify Your Data: Get a single set of values across systems. Make that 360-degree customer view a reality.

Question on: ibi Omni-Gen
How is Omni-Gen approach Incremental and what advantage does Omni-Gen have over other tools and products in the data management category?Data Management

Companies are afraid to take on Master Data Management projects because they are “just too big” and they take “way too long”. Omni-Gen gives you the ability to rapidly bring up your first domain and quickly realize the value. Omni-Gen can do this because its primary advantage is speed of deployment.
The typical Master Data Management project today take about twelve to eighteen months to achieve. This is also why many of them fail. What Omni-Gen does is shrink the amount of time it takes to get to a golden record. What used to take twelve to eighteen months can now be accomplished in three.
